Output 91a696461006eca344b3ebb324ac78974305391a20d9783d5f2f0113d04f50c4:1

value
51049970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92be7c6366f69b4361fc84f2b216243a73ea0d91 OP_EQUAL
address
3F4vmk2yWRDc9sYAKoXidnuhR7NUCBb2vL
transaction
91a696461006eca344b3ebb324ac78974305391a20d9783d5f2f0113d04f50c4
confirmations
450022
spent
true